Analyst – Power BI & KPI Dashboard
Baker Hughes
Provides innovative solutions for energy, industrial, and infrastructure sectors globally.
Develop and maintain interactive Power BI dashboards to track operational KPIs in materials planning, inventory, product delivery, and procurement. Analyze supply chain and materials management KPIs, and partner with global teams to drive data-informed decisions.

Role
What you would be doing

Supporting global stakeholders with ad-hoc analysis and KPI insights to drive data-informed decisions.
Generating regular reports and presentations for global and regional management reviews.
Partnering with Product Delivery Planners, Engineers, and Materials Managers to translate business requirements into meaningful dashboards and analytics.
Working closely with Product Lines across the globe to align reporting standards and performance metrics.
Continuously enhance visualization and reporting standards for effective decision support.
Ensuring data consistency, accuracy, and integrity across reporting tools.
Automating data pipelines and ensuring dashboard accuracy, timeliness, and usability for leadership and stakeholders.
Monitoring and analyzing key supply chain and materials management KPIs (e.g., on-time delivery, inventory turns, lead times, backlog health, slot adherence).
Developing and documenting data definitions, reporting standards, and processes.
Validating and cleansing large datasets from ERP/MRP systems (SAP, Oracle, or equivalent).
Providing deep-dive analysis and highlight trends, risks, and improvement opportunities.
Designing, developing, and maintaining interactive Power BI dashboards to track operational KPIs across materials planning, inventory, product delivery and procurement
What you bring

Be Detail-oriented with 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
Be Proficient in Excel, SQL, and ERP/MRP systems (SAP, Oracle, or equivalent).
Have strong analytical and problem-solving mindset.
Have good understanding of KPIs related to materials management, supply chain, and production planning.
Have 2–5 years in data analysis, reporting, or supply chain analytics (preferably in manufacturing or Oil & Gas equipment).
Have a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Supply Chain, Data Analytics, or related field.
Desired to have experience in Oil & Gas equipment or Subsea manufacturing is desirable but not mandatory.
Have strong expertise in Power BI (DAX, Power Query, Data Modeling, Row-Level Security).
Have excellent communication and stakeholder management abilities across global, cross-cultural teams.
